Definition and Role of the City Attorney's Office

The Office of the City Attorney plays a crucial role in municipal governance by providing legal advice and representation to the city. It is tasked with ensuring that the city's operations comply with federal, state, and local laws. The office advises city officials on legal matters, drafts and reviews legislation, and represents the city in legal proceedings. This ensures that all municipal activities are conducted within a legal framework that upholds public trust and protects city interests.

Functions and Responsibilities

Advisory Services

  • Legal Counsel: The City Attorney’s Office offers advice to city departments and officials on a wide range of legal issues, including land use, employment law, and contracts.
  • Legislative Drafting: It assists in drafting ordinances and resolutions, providing legal language that aligns with city policy objectives and legal standards.

Representation in Legal Matters

  • Litigation: The office represents the city in lawsuits, advocating on the city's behalf in courts.
  • Negotiations: It is involved in negotiating contracts and settlements that are in the city’s best interest, ensuring legality and fairness.

Eligibility Criteria for Utilizing City Attorney Services

City employees, officials, and departments are typically eligible to receive services from the City Attorney’s Office. However, individual residents or businesses may access certain services, such as public information inquiries or participating in public meetings.

decoration image ratings of Dochub

Legal Use and Restrictions

The City Attorney’s Office is restricted to providing services only in legal matters pertaining to city governance. It does not offer personal legal advice to individuals or represent private cases. This ensures the office’s focus remains on municipal legal affairs, contributing to efficient and unbiased city governance.

Important Terminology

Key Terms to Understand

  • Ordinance: A local law enacted by the city’s legislative body.
  • Resolution: A formal expression of opinion or intention agreed upon by the city’s legislative body.
  • Litigation: The process of taking legal action; in this context, it refers to lawsuits involving the city.

State-specific Rules and Variations

The powers and functions of the City Attorney’s Office can vary by state due to differing local government structures and state laws. This may impact the specific legal frameworks within which the office operates.

Examples of Common Cases Handled

  • Land Use Disputes: Addressing conflicts over zoning, property use, and development plans.
  • Employment Issues: Resolving legal matters involving city employees and employment policies.
  • Contract Negotiations: Overseeing agreements between the city and contractors or service providers.
